Dicerothamnus is a genus of flowering plants belonging to the family Asteraceae.[1]
Its native range is South African Republic.[1]
Species:[1]
- Dicerothamnus adpressus (Harv.) Koek.
- Dicerothamnus rhinocerotis (L.f.) Koek.
